Transaction 7e6185a72d318dcf0905a72ea2e516fa9bd1fb60e707216da16c2d03f5ccee6a

7 Input
1 Outputs
  • 7e6185a72d318dcf0905a72ea2e516fa9bd1fb60e707216da16c2d03f5ccee6a:0
  • value  4106102
    address  3H8x7uCtsQ8D2GEJpNttXwrWohD1F6Na94